New York: Grammercy, 1996. Book. Near Fine. Hardcover. 1st Edition. 9 1/2 h x 6 1/4w. A real nice clean unmarked 329 page first edition hardcover with "1" present in number line. Has just a little aging and is very nice. Renowned occultist and clergyman Montague Summers explores the realm of Dracula, Anne Rice's INTERVIEW WITH A VAMPIRE and stunning monsters. He comes up with some very shocking possibilities as well as "true tales" of terror from England, Ireland, Hungary, Bulgaria, Romania, Greece, and other places..
